Silence, a book to be read with the senses Silence is a collection of poems by way of micro-stories that relate feelings and sensory experiences, in many synesthetic occasions. It is independent sentences, but also as a whole short story. This book of poetry illustrated relief to read and play for both sighted and blind people, offering a new tactile communication for all. The book has a cover, back cover and sheet loans, inside cover, 14 pages each with poetry represented in the two alphabets, 14 pages of illustrations and description in Braille just below these for facilitars your understanding. Feel free to contact me on the website :) http://tactilebook.tk/index_english.html Print Settings Printer: Witbox 2 Notes: The height of layer used was 0.2 for the pages to not have a thickness too high and the printing time is reduced. Printing temperature used was 235 degrees knowing that it obscile between 230-240 (since it is not stable) in order to create a homogeneous surface. Retractions should be as fast and far as possible to not waste that does not generate unwanted. http://tactilebook.tk/print_your_book.html Post-Printing Binding Each page has a bridge and 5 holes. High bridge allows to fold the pages providing greater flexibility. The binding was intended to facilitate the DIY (do it yourself). This binding based enquadernadors is accessible anywhere in the world and also economic. In addition the page layout opens the door to multiple possible bindings. http://tactilebook.tk/about_the_book.html How I Designed This The material The material with which the book is printed is flexible filament, it's very elastic and comfortable to the touch. The page dimensions are relative to the size of the medium area of the current 3D printers.
